Thread scalar comma operator (25 answers)
Opened by KurtZ at 2008-12-31 02:05

KurtZ
 2008-01-08 17:26
#104489 #104489
User since
2007-12-13
411 Artikel
BenutzerIn
[default_avatar]
Schönes Neues,

pq+2007-12-31 12:26:33--
nein. das zweite beispiel hat ein block-eval, das ist überhaupt
nicht aequivalent. wenn dann eher do {}; aber ein do drumherum
ist eine extra operation und mehr zu schreiben.


du hast natürlich recht, do war mir entfallen.

Allerdings finde ich das der "comma operator" syntaktisch zu oft greift.

Insbesondere Codepattern die die Rückgabe des letzten Wertes brauchen???
Die kommen viel zu selten vor, als das gerechtfertigt wäre dafür die Orthogonalität zur Arraynutzung zu brechen.

Ich habe versucht schlau zu werden ob das in perl6 anders wird, bin aber nicht weiter gekommen. Blickt von euch jemand durch?

Gruß
Kurt
TMTOWTDYOG (there's more than one way to dig your own grave)

View full thread scalar comma operator